    After a cracking opening event for the season, the Pakenham Auto Club returns with our second Khanacross for 2024, with our all-new layout set to be pressed into service again.

    The grounds are in fantastic shape, with the PAC Army making sure that the grounds look great, and the circuit is in top nick for competitors.

    Have you never heard of Khanacrossing? Drop by on the day to check out the action on our challenging grass/dirt-based circuit, with a wide range of machinery and drivers – from age 12 and up.

    This is the best value-for-money motorsport you can get – you can run your road car, a suitable unregistered car, through to more developed competition-spec machinery.

Pakenham Auto Club was founded in 1972 by local motoring enthusiasts keen to enjoy motorsports events in safe, controlled environments.

Sanctioned by Motorsport Australia, Pakenham Auto Club support all motor sport disciplines with active membership involved in rally, motorkhana, historics, hillclimbs and circuit racing events.

The club's grounds in Pakenham provide Melbourne with a high-quality grassroots outlet for motorkhana and khanacross activities.
